Very beautifull! Interesting temporary exhibitions...

Very beautifull! Interesting temporary exhibitions but I do something VERY important: the Albertina has an extremely large collection of works that makes "rotate" every 5-10 years thanks to temporary exhibitions. Some works, such as the famous Durer's LEPRE and some beautiful Michelangelo's nude studies are not advertised at all and are on display on the 2nd floor, where there are real apartments (I think they are called that). Don't make the mistake of skipping them as we did thinking of seeing these works on display in exhibitions on other floors. Fortunately, half an hour before closing, we asked a guard!
